Working Principle
Based on measuring corrosion coupon loss of metal, the system calculates corrosion loss rate by measuring changes of AC signals caused by the thickness reduction of corrosion sample. It is an effective method to monitor the corrosion of the device indirectly. The measurement element installed in the tubular alters the AC signal when corrosion reduces its cross-sectional area. We can calculate the amount of reduction and the corrosion rate based on the changes in the AC signal applied to the testing sample. When the material of the testing sample and the erosion conditions caused by the medium are similar to those of the device being monitored, we can consider the corrosion rate of the device to be comparable to that of the testing sample.
Inductance probe monitoring technology is an emerging corrosion on line measuring technology since 2000 and has been successfully applied widely in China mainland. The system features high sensitivity, quick response, high anti-interference performance, and broad applicability, etc. Under the same principle, testing sample can be fabricated into different shapes for various applications. Usually the measurement resolution ratio of inductive probe is 30nm, assuming the corrosion rate is 0.254mm/a, the system can identify the amount of corrosion reduction of one hour. General age (Max. loss) of the system is 0.25mm

Main Features of the Inductance Probe
Indirect corrosion measurement:
The system indirectly reflects the pipeline corrosion rate caused by the medium by calculating the corrosion rate of the testing sample. It does this by measuring the accumulated thickness reduction caused by corrosion over a period of time.
Independent of the corrosion coupon system:
Operators can use the corrosion monitoring system to measure corrosion in both liquid and gaseous environments. It applies to both electrolyte and non-electrolyte corrosion systems.
It is a comparatively universal online corrosion monitoring method with strong anti-interfence capability by applying AC signals as measuring signals.
Tubular detector and probe body are welded into one piece and infilled with high temperature cured adhesive thus possesses stronger resistance to pitting corrosion, erosion, and pressure than ER probe.
Temperature compensatory testing sample is wrapped in and be in the same level with the testing sample, therefore the testing result has little affection by temperature.
